And what it all means. The chairman of the d. C. Police union says even though only a third of their Union Members voted, the message is still clear. They say chief lanier cannot be trusted, has created a toxic environment and without change they fear the violence will continue. So far our murder rate here in d. C. Stands at 105, the same as all of 2014. Residents report gunfights happening in every quadrant of the city. The latest a double shooting on 3rd and k street southwest. Sunday evening a 13yearold girl who was walking home from the library was among those shot. Police Union Members blame the uptick in violence on the dismantling of the vice squad and Record Number of retirements. We used to get members that stay here 35, 45 years. At 25 years and one day theyre leaving. Theyre not leaving because of the union. Theyre leaving because of the leadership style of the current chief.
